I think I have a seal on the lower unit leaking by, last year I had oil comming out of the hub behind the prop when the boat sat idle. Then when I went to change the lower unit oil this spring it was a milky color so I no I got water in it. Any ideas on where to start.
I had the same issue 2 years ago. Take it to a shop and have them perform a leak down test. This will allow you to pinpoint where the leak is coming from instead of guessing. My guy charged me $50.....It was worth it. Good luck!
